So i went back down to TX2K again this year. It was held at Royal purple raceway this time, which was honestly badass!

I had some boost control issues and the Ecu kept glitching and couldn't pull logs half the time.

Basically 50% on my boost controller is normally am at = 30psi...

Well down there, 32% = 33psi... 20% =26psi and 0% = 22psi.. lol

I didnt have time to check it, and to be honest **** ripped so i kept it how it was LOL..


Anyway i was totally going to run slicks, but of course i made the 40hr drive (well i flew but the cars were trailered haha) and forgot some big parts i need... Since i have the 6 piston Wilwood brakes it uses different brake lines.... So i couldnt toss my small brakes back on. SO off to street tires i go!

Can only do so well on a R888 at 750whp

Problem was, TC wasn't working for one. And i didn't realize i was brake boosting 26psi in 3rd lol. And when it HIT it hit hard.


After I started brake boosting and kept it around 15psi it hooked much better
